R108 KGP is a 1998 Chrysler Jeep Cherokee in Black with a 3,960c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 53.8%.
Across all 1998 Chrysler Jeep Cherokee models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.4% with a typical mileage of 99,773 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Chrysler Jeep Cherokee f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 1,638 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R108 KGP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Chrysler Jeep Cherokee typ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 28 years old, this Chrysler Jeep Cherokee is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
